[QUOTE="Rossterman, post: 1516621, member: 30027"] As said above, you need a set of gauges to determine what is going on. Once you have readings, folks here can help point to how to repair your situation. Harbor frieght makes a usable set for $80 (less if you use one of their coupons). A/C isn’t that technical that you need to pay someone $1000s to diagnose and repair it. Also add some leak dye to the system now so if it turns out it’s undercharged, you can determine the leak location. Two common ones are the high and low pressure schrader valves used to fill and drain the system. You can simply pour a little water down the fitting and see if any bubbles come out. Make sure to use a paper towel to remove and completely dry the area before installing the dustcaps back on though. Also, stay away from those recharge cans with leak seal. These typically do more harm then good by gumming up the internals. [/QUOTE]
